Abstract
A filler for optical isomer separation which: allows a polymer compound derivative to be immobilized on the surface of a carrier at a high ratio and is excellent in optical separation ability. The filler is characterized in that the filler is obtained by modifying part of the hydroxy or amino groups of a polymer compound having the hydroxy or amino groups with molecules of a compound represented by the following general formula (I): A-X—Si(Y)R, and is carried by a carrier through chemical bonding.
